A new industry book, Biodiesel America, was launched by author Josh Tickell during Monday's general session and also at an evening book signing reception. Another launch of sorts took place with a major fleet announcement at the Tuesday general session.
Sysco, the leading food distributor and one of the largest private not-for-hire trucking fleets in the United States, announced it was using B5 in hundreds of trucks. DaimlerChrysler also discussed its recent decision to specifically cover the use of B20 in the 2007 model year Dodge Ram pickup truck for government, military and commercial fleets (see page 24).
Other general session speakers included NBB Chairman Darryl Brinkmann and Thomas Dorr of the USDA Energy Council, who discussed "Great Strides for Biodiesel." All conference attendees received some of the biodiesel star treatment as they were able to drive the newest offerings by diesel automakers Volkswagen, DaimlerChrysler and General Motors, including the Dodge Ram, Volkswagen Jetta, Jeep Liberty and Chevrolet Savannah.
